If a patient has a laparoscopic cholecystectomy converted to an open cholecystectomy, the icd-10-pcs coding guidelines require t

hat the coder must assign the code for
Biology
1 answer:
masya89 [10]3 years ago
6 0
The ICD-10-PCS coding guidelines have need of that the coder to do both percutaneous endoscopic inspection and open resection of the gallbladder. In addition, laparoscopic cholecystectomy is a process in instance that the gallbladder is detached by the use of laparoscopic methods. The laparoscopic surgery also denoted to as slightly hostile surgery that defines the enactment of surgical techniques with the help of a video camera and several thin tools while a cholecystectomy may be essential if a person is experiencing aching from gallstones that block the movement of bile. A cholecystectomy is a common surgery and it brings only a small possibility of impediments.

Outline the biochemical pathways which enables cells to produce energy using glucose and oxygen
Eduardwww [97]

Cellular respiration is a metabolic pathway that breaks down glucose and produces ATP.

<h3>What is respiration?</h3>

Respiration is the process in which cells use oxygen to break down sugar in order to obtain energy. Glycolysis, pyruvate oxidation, the citric acid or Krebs cycle, and oxidative phosphorylation are the stages of cellular respiration.

So we can conclude that Cellular respiration is a metabolic pathway that breaks down glucose and produces ATP.
